Raikkonen rubbishes WRC rumours

Kimi Raikkonen has rubbished claims that he's off to the World Rally Championship next season with Toyota with the manufacturer also saying it is 'pure speculation.' Last week a report in the Finnish media stated that the Ferrari driver was in talks with Toyota about a rally drive. And although Raikkonen competed in the World Rally Champion when he took a break from Formula 1, he says this report is nothing but a rumour. He told RaceFans: 'If you speak to the lady who write it you'll probably find out there's not much knowledge about racing or anything else. 'It's rumours and [their] ideas. 'For sure I'm interested in rallying whenever I stop, that's not a secret but I have zero contract...
